About Wainhouse Corner

Wainhouse Corner holds the high, windswept ground of North Cornwall where the Atlantic air carries the sharp, salt-crusted tang of the nearby cliffs. It lies 7.1 miles south of Bude (from Bude: bearing 191°T, OS grid SX 182 954), and is situated west-south-west of Jacobstow village.
